The Convergence of Art and Science: The Legacy of Franz Michael Regenfuss In the vibrant intellectual landscape of the eighteenth century, few figures embodied the era's thirst for discovery as elegantly as Franz Michael Regenfuss. A German artist, engraver, and naturalist hailing from Nuremberg, Regenfuss occupied a unique space where the precision of scientific inquiry met the delicate beauty of fine art.
